Double glazing can be equipped with flaps for dogs and cats that allow your pet to go and go at their own pace. They are also great for keeping an eye on your pet when you are away from home.
It is possible to fit a cat flap inside an existing uPVC panel or double glazing glass sealed unit, however you'll need a replacement piece that has a hole already made. A glazier is able to do this with the proper equipment and training.

A cat flap glazier who is certified will be able to give advice on which pet flap is the best fit for your door, and will be able to discuss the various options available. They will take measurements of the existing door or window and then design a brand new glass panel with a hole that is pre-cut for the flap. The panel is then put inside your glass door to ensure a perfect fit. This process takes between four to five days from the time it is measured.
You can also put in magnetic pet flaps that function by reading the microchip on your pet's collar. This means that only your pet is able to use the flap, and also prevents other dogs and cats from entering your home. However, they are not suitable for double-glazed doors containing metal (even some UPVC units are reinforced with hidden steel) and are easily defeated by thieves.

While it is possible to install a cat flap onto an existing glass door or window but the process is difficult and can damage the unit. Double glazed units are made of two insulated panes, and cutting them can compromise their insulation properties. It can also lead to drafts and moisture to develop between the units.
The best solution is to replace the existing double-glazed doors or windows with a new set of windows that come with an already-cut hole for the pet flap. This will preserve the windows' insulation properties, which will reduce heat loss as well as the infiltration of cold air. This is also cheaper than replacing the double-glazed unit. The task should be done by a certified glazier as it is a complicated job that can damage glass units.

There are a variety of options for cat flaps that can be fitted into double glazing. These include microchip doors, infrared flaps and magnetic/electromagnetic door locks. Some of these are not suitable for metal doors (such as aluminum and a few UPVC units), because they use magnetic or IR technology that can interfere with. These doors are usually controlled by a microchip attached to your pet's collar tag. They can be locked the door or allow in or out movement. They are great to keep unwanted cats and strays out of your home.
If you're thinking about purchasing cat flaps for your glass doors, it's important to note that you are not able to install one in existing glazed panels since it would break the seal between the panes of glass. cat flap installation in glass doors near me could result in cold air entering your home and condensation forming between the panes when temperatures change. You'll need a brand new sealed unit as well as a hole made for the flap for pets.
